Shapley values, derived from cooperative game theory, offer a mathematical framework for fairly distributing payouts among players based on their contributions to a coalition. In the context of artificial intelligence, particularly Explainable Artificial Intelligence (XAI), Shapley values provide a way to attribute the contributions of individual features to the overall prediction made by a model. This concept is critical as it enables developers and users to interpret the results of complex algorithms, ensuring that AI decisions are not just black boxes, but rather transparent processes that can be understood and trusted. By quantifying the impact of each feature on a model's output, Shapley values bridge the gap between technical AI functionality and human understanding, making them invaluable tools in the realm of data science and machine learning.
In XAI, the primary aim is to make AI systems more understandable and interpretable. Shapley values play a pivotal role in achieving this goal by providing insights that help users comprehend how different features influence model predictions. For instance, consider a credit scoring model predicting whether a loan should be approved. By applying Shapley values, stakeholders can see not only the predicted outcome but also how much each feature—such as income, credit history, or debt-to-income ratio—contributed to that decision. This level of detail is essential for organizations that must comply with regulations and wish to maintain customer trust. Furthermore, Shapley values can help identify biases in AI models, enabling developers to adjust algorithms and improve fairness. By understanding the contribution of each feature, developers can ensure that the AI system behaves ethically and meets societal standards.
The advantages of using Shapley values in XAI are manifold. Firstly, they offer a unique approach to interpreting model predictions, allowing for a fair and equitable distribution of contribution scores among features. This is particularly important in complex models like ensemble methods and neural networks, where the interplay between features can be intricate. Secondly, Shapley values provide a clear and intuitive explanation of AI decisions, making them accessible to non-technical stakeholders. For example, a healthcare provider can use Shapley values to explain why a patient is at risk for a particular condition, thus facilitating informed discussions about treatment options. Additionally, organizations can leverage these insights to bolster their compliance efforts, as transparency in AI decision-making processes is increasingly being mandated by regulatory bodies. Overall, the use of Shapley values not only enhances interpretability but also promotes trust and accountability in AI systems.
Shapley values have been successfully employed across various industries to enhance the interpretability of AI systems. In finance, companies like ZestFinance utilize Shapley values to explain credit scoring decisions, enabling customers to understand why they were approved or denied loans. This not only helps customers but also aids in improving the model by identifying which features are most predictive of creditworthiness. In healthcare, Shapley values are used to analyze patient data and predict outcomes, allowing doctors to understand the factors that contribute to a patient’s risk for diseases. For instance, a model predicting diabetes risk can reveal that family history and lifestyle choices are significant contributors, thus guiding preventative measures. The automotive industry also benefits from Shapley values; companies are using them to interpret decisions made by autonomous vehicles, ensuring that safety protocols are met and understood by users. These real-world applications illustrate the versatility of Shapley values and their critical role in fostering transparency and understanding in AI systems.
Organizations looking to implement Shapley values in their AI systems should start by integrating tools and frameworks that support this methodology. Libraries such as SHAP (SHapley Additive exPlanations) provide easy access to Shapley value calculations for various machine learning models. By utilizing these tools, data scientists can generate Shapley value explanations for their models and integrate them into their existing workflows. Additionally, organizations should prioritize training for their teams on the importance of interpretability in AI, ensuring that all stakeholders understand how to leverage Shapley values effectively. Creating a culture of transparency is vital; organizations should encourage open discussions about AI decisions and foster an environment where feedback is welcomed. By actively seeking to explain AI outputs, companies can build trust with their users and stakeholders, ultimately leading to better decision-making processes and improved customer relationships. These steps are essential for any organization aiming to enhance its AI systems' interpretability and trustworthiness.
While Shapley values offer significant advantages in XAI, there are challenges associated with their implementation. One of the primary issues is computational complexity. Calculating Shapley values can be resource-intensive, especially for models with a large number of features. This complexity can lead to longer processing times, which may not be feasible for real-time applications. Organizations need to balance the need for interpretability with the practical considerations of performance. Another challenge is the proper interpretation of Shapley values. Stakeholders must understand that while Shapley values provide insights into feature contributions, they do not imply causality. Misinterpretations can lead to incorrect conclusions about which features are most influential. To mitigate these challenges, organizations should invest in enhancing computational efficiency by adopting approximation methods or sampling techniques. Additionally, providing comprehensive training on the interpretation of Shapley values will help users avoid potential pitfalls and leverage the insights effectively. By addressing these challenges head-on, organizations can optimize the use of Shapley values in their AI systems.
In conclusion, Shapley values are a powerful tool in the realm of Explainable AI, providing critical insights into model predictions and ensuring transparency in AI decision-making processes. As organizations continue to adopt AI technologies, understanding and implementing Shapley values will not only enhance interpretability but also foster trust among users. If you’re looking to improve your AI systems, consider exploring how Shapley values can be integrated into your workflows today!